Abstract
Aim To study the pharmacokinetics of bezafibrate tablets in human plasma.Methods Twenty volunteers were given bezafibrate tablets by oral administration with 2-way crossover design.The concentration of bezafibrate in plasma was determined by HPLC.The pharmacokinetic parameters were calculated by DAS software.Results The calibration curve was linear in the range from 0.1μg·mL-1 to 20.0μg·mL-1.The relative recovery exceeded 92.47%.The intra and inter-day RSD was less than 11.1%.The main pharmacokinetic parameters t1/2,Cmax,Tmax and AUC0→t for the test capsules were(1.63±0.28)h,(11.107±3.184)μg·mL-1,(1.85±0.49)h and(38.9±9.6)μg·h·mL-1,respectively.while those for the reference preparations were(1.57±0.42)h,(11.439±3.388)μg·mL-1,(1.65±0.46)h and(37.4±10.4)μg·h·mL-1,respectively.The relative bioavalability of the test preparations was(105.7±12.8)%.Conclusion The HPLC method for determination of bezafibrate in plasma was proved to be sensitive,accurate and convenient.The reference and test preparations are bioequivalent.
